Legal Issues
- 1 Whether the administrators failed to bequeath the estate to the rightful heir
- 2 Whether the administrators failed to file inventory and accounts as required by law
- 3 Whether the applicant is entitled to revocation of grant and appointment as administrator
Ratio Decidendi
The administrators failed to conclusively demonstrate compliance with statutory duties to file inventory and accounts. The court ordered them to file a full inventory and account within six months, finding this necessary for justice and compliance with the law.
Court Disposition
Application partly granted
Orders
- Administrators to file in court, within six months, an inventory containing a full and true estimate of all property, credits, and debts of the estate, along with an account showing assets received and their application or disposal.
